Today (June 22, 2016), we have lost yet another gem of a personality, the successor of famous Sabri qawaal family- Sir Amjad Hussain Sabri. Amjad sb was a true artist by every mean. As he was born in December 23 in the famous qawaal/ musical family and stunned everyone by his sheer talent. Being a musical prodigy, he continued the legacy of his late father Mr. Ghulam Fareed Sabri and further established the name of his family by reciting Naats & Qawaalis not only in Pakistan but all over the world. Today it feels like the era of qawaali is almost gone, as far as Sabri family is concerned, as Amjad Sabri has been murdered brutally in Karachi.

Ashutosh Gowariker who stunned everyone by making one of the biggest sagas of Bollywood with Amir Khan "Lagaan" and later on made yet another impressive movie Jodha Akbar with Hrithik Roshan. Where Lagaan was based on the era of British Raj in Indo-Pak subcontinent, he went further in past with Jodha Akbar and showcased Mughals era in a very authentic manner. If this much history was not sufficient, he decided to take all of us in a past, no one could have envisaged in Bollywood. Before British raj, before Mughals, before Christ, even before Buddha, there was Mohenjo Daro. Here is Ashutosh Gowariker presenting the bygone era starring Hrithik Roshan in lead.

Hrithik Roshan is looking stunning as usual. His dialogue delivery has that authentic power in every sequence that will surely leaves an unforgettable impact upon the viewers. The trailer of Mohenjo Daro explicitly relies on three major thing, solid presence of Hrithik Roshan, excellent art direction & an awesome sound track by legendary musician Sir AR Rehman.

To me it is one hell of a task to showcase an era for which we do not have sufficient information available at our hands. It remains to be seen how Ashutosh has managed to get the things done in the right manner in totality. Nevertheless this trailer has surely risen the expectations. It does ask for more.
